Core Scientific, Inc. and Manhattan Associates, Inc. side by side — fundamentals from SEC filings, refreshed nightly. Sector: Technology.
| Core Scientific, Inc. (CORZ) | Manhattan Associates, Inc. (MANH) | |
|---|---|---|
| Market cap | $8.4B | $8.6B |
| Revenue (latest FY) | $319.02M | $1.08B |
| Net income (latest FY) | $-288.62M | $219.95M |
| Revenue growth (5y CAGR) | 39.5% | 13.0% |
| Net margin | -90.5% | 20.3% |
| Return on equity | 30.0% | 69.9% |
| P/E ratio | — | 40.7 |
| Dividend yield | — | — |
| Profitable years (of last 10) | 1 | 10 |
| Positive free cash flow | No | Yes |
